LA teachers' strike all but certain as union rejects district's latest offer
by Howard Blume, John Myers and Sonali Kohli, Los Angeles Times
Jan 12, 2019
2 minutes
LOS ANGELES –– Negotiations between the Los Angeles Unified School District and the union representing its teachers ended Friday with no deal in sight. All signs point to the first strike in 30 years in the nation's second-largest school system.
